However, a direct comparison between overall sex-aggregated sham and BLG-sensitized groups indicated that the difference between the groups did not reach statistical significance (Supplementary Fig. 4-3 , p = 0.1651, Student’s t-test), suggesting that the significant main effect of sensitization was influenced by the combination of sex and treatment factors.

Female BLG mice showed only a decreasing trend in the discrimination index in a sex-disaggregated analysis (Fig. 4 h; p = 0.1837, 2-way ANOVA), and thioperamide treatment did not appreciably improve this trend ( p = 0.0924, 2-way ANOVA).

The male BLG group also showed a trend of becoming immobile earlier, although this measurement was not statistically different from the sham group (Fig. 4 d; open vs. filled green bars, p = 0.2281; 2-way ANOVA).
